SPHS Carries Ball for Paulding in Playoffs

South Paulding was the lone county team to make it to the second round of the Georgia High School Association football playoffs.

From Paulding County ‘Athletic Adventures’

The Georgia High School Association began the first round of the state Football playoffs last Friday, as 32 teams in each classification began their quest for a state championship.

The Paulding County School District had three teams competing in the playoffs.

South Paulding grabbed the runner up position in Region 5-AAAAA and was the only team that advanced to the second round. South defeated Loganville in their first round match up by a score of 34-16.

The Spartans are advancing to face Drew High School. Drew the #4 seed out of Region 4-AAAAA defeated Carver-Columbus last week to advance.
